How to Host a Dinner Party on a Budget
Throw a memorable dinner party without overspending. Learn budget-friendly menu planning, smart shopping strategies, and hosting tips that impress every guest.
Great Dinner Parties Are About People, Not Price Tags
Many people avoid hosting because they think a dinner party requires expensive ingredients, elaborate dishes, and professional-level cooking skills. The reality is that the most memorable gatherings are defined by warmth, conversation, and the effort of bringing people together, not by how much money was spent. Some of the world's most beloved dishes, from Italian pasta to Indian curries to Mexican tacos, originated as humble, affordable meals. With smart planning and a few key strategies, you can host a fantastic dinner party on almost any budget.
Planning a Budget-Friendly Menu
The menu is where most of your budget will go, so plan it strategically. Choose a theme or cuisine that naturally relies on affordable staple ingredients. Pasta dishes, soups, curries, and taco or bowl bars are all crowd-pleasers that cost relatively little per person. Avoid menus centered around expensive proteins like steak or shrimp. Instead, use cheaper cuts like chicken thighs or pork shoulder, or go with vegetarian options like hearty bean chili or vegetable lasagna. One impressive homemade dish served with simple sides creates more impact than multiple mediocre courses.
Smart Budget Strategies
Cook one main dish in large quantity rather than multiple small dishes, which reduces ingredient costs and simplifies preparation
Make your own appetizers like bruschetta, hummus with vegetables, or a simple cheese board rather than buying pre-made platters
Ask guests to bring a dish, bottle of wine, or dessert to share, turning the dinner into a potluck-style gathering that splits costs naturally
Prepare a signature batch cocktail or sangria pitcher instead of stocking a full bar, which is both cheaper and more memorable
Use seasonal produce and store-brand staples to keep ingredient costs low without sacrificing freshness or flavor
Setting the Scene Without Spending Much
Atmosphere matters, but it does not require expensive decorations. Dim the overhead lights and use candles or string lights for warm, flattering illumination. A simple tablecloth, even a clean bedsheet, transforms a basic table. Fresh herbs or wildflowers in small glasses make charming, practically free centerpieces. Create a simple playlist that matches the mood of the evening. These small touches signal to your guests that you put thought and care into the evening, which matters far more than elaborate decor or matching dinnerware.
Timing and Preparation
The biggest mistake budget hosts make is trying to do too much at the last minute, which leads to stress, mistakes, and sometimes emergency spending. Choose dishes that can be prepared largely in advance so you are not stuck in the kitchen when guests arrive. Soups, stews, lasagna, and braised dishes all taste better the next day and can be made entirely ahead of time. Set the table and prepare garnishes hours before guests arrive. The more you can do in advance, the more relaxed and present you will be as a host.
